Fluxo de Comunicação Low Code

Introdução

O Fluxo de Comunicação Low Code é uma aplicação diretamente ligada à automatização de processos repetitivos utilizando um chatbot. Esta solução permite a execução de tarefas como envio de faturas, notas fiscais, buscas de pedidos em aberto, cadastro de leads em cmr ou sistemas de gestão entre outros muitos procedimentos, sem a necessidade de contato com um agente humano.

Funcionalidades Principais

  1. Criação e configuração de fluxos de comunicação personalizados
  2. Configuração de cards de pergunta com validação de respostas
  3. Integração com sistemas externos via requisições HTTP Request
  4. Implementação de lógica condicional dinâmica
  5. Tratamento de erros e tentativas múltiplas
  6. Pré e pós request em JavaScript

Campos Principais

CampoDescrição
NomeNome do fluxo de comunicação
PaísPaís de aplicação do fluxo
InteraçãoCampo opcional para interações específicas
VariáveisVariáveis a serem preenchidas antes de executar o fluxo
EndpointRota da função para requisições HTTP
MétodoGET para buscas, POST para envios
HeadersInformações adicionais como autenticação
BodyCorpo e estrutura da requisição
Query ParamsParâmetros da requisição
CondiçãoCritério para execução de ações condicionais

1. Criar um novo fluxo

  • Clique no botão Novo, disponível no menu de três pontos no canto inferior direito da tela.

2. Preencher as informações do fluxo

Informe os seguintes campos:

  • Nome: Identificação do fluxo.

  • País: Localidade onde o fluxo será utilizado.

  • Intenção: Palavras ou frases que representam o objetivo do fluxo.

  • Variáveis obrigatórias antes da execução: Dados que precisam estar preenchidos para que o fluxo seja executado corretamente.

Dica

Adicionar mais palavras no campo Intenção melhora o reconhecimento da intenção, porém aumenta o consumo de tokens da sua conta OpenAI.

Atenção

O nome das variáveis deve seguir um dos formatos abaixo:

  • lowercase (ex: nomevariavel)

  • camelCase (ex: nomeVariavel)

  • snake_case (ex: nome_variavel)

3. Salvar o fluxo

  • Após preencher todas as informações, clique em Salvar.

4. Abrir o fluxo para configuração

  • Localize o fluxo criado na listagem.

  • Clique no ícone de três pontos e selecione Abrir.


Configuração do Fluxo

Adicionar um card de Pergunta

  • Selecione Interações → Enviar Pergunta.

  • Configure:

    • Texto da pergunta

    • Variável de resposta

    • Tipo de validação

Adicionar uma Requisição HTTP

  • Selecione Ferramenta do sistema → Requisição HTTP.

  • Configure:

    • Integração

    • Endpoint

    • Método HTTP

    • Parâmetros necessários

Adicionar uma Condicional Dinâmica

  • Selecione Ferramenta do sistema → Condicional.

  • Configure:

    • Variável a ser avaliada

    • Condição lógica

    • Valor para verificação

8. Salvar todas as configurações

  • Certifique-se de salvar todas as alterações realizadas no fluxo.

Fluxograma

graph TD
    A[Início] --> B[Acessar Menu]
    B --> C[Criar Novo Fluxo]
    C --> D[Configurar Informações Básicas]
    D --> E[Salvar Fluxo]
    E --> F[Editar Fluxo]
    F --> G[Adicionar Card de Pergunta]
    G --> H[Configurar Requisição HTTP]
    H --> I[Adicionar Condicional Dinâmica]
    I --> J[Salvar Configurações]
    J --> K[Fim]

Considerações Finais

O Fluxo de Comunicação Low Code oferece uma solução eficiente para automatizar processos de atendimento, permitindo interações personalizadas e reduzindo a necessidade de intervenção humana em tarefas repetitivas. Com a capacidade de configurar requisições HTTP e condicionais dinâmicas, esta ferramenta proporciona uma experiência de atendimento mais ágil e eficaz para os clientes.

Etiquetas

FluxoDeComunicacao LowCode Automatizacao Chatbot RequisicoesHTTP CondicionalDinamica

Leia Também